Claims (4)
- 車室内に空気を吹き出す空調送風手段と、空調モードとして、車室外の空気を車室内に導通する外気導入モードと、車室内で空気を循環させる内気循環モードとを有する空調制御部とを具備する車両に搭載され、前記車両の駆動用の電池を冷却する電池冷却手段と、該電池冷却手段の作動を制御する冷却手段制御部と、を備える車両の冷却装置であって、
前記冷却手段制御部は、前記空調モード及び前記空調送風手段の作動状態の両方に応じて前記電池冷却手段の作動状態を変更することを特徴とする車両の冷却装置。 - 前記冷却手段制御部は、前記空調モードが外気導入モードであり、前記空調送風手段が作動している場合には、前記電池冷却手段の作動を抑制することを特徴とする請求項1記載の車両の冷却装置。
- 前記冷却手段制御部は、前記空調送風手段が高出力で作動するほど、前記電池冷却手段の作動を抑制することを特徴とする請求項1又は2記載の車両の冷却装置。
- 前記車両は、電気自動車であることを特徴とする請求項1から3のいずれか一項に記載の車両の冷却装置。
